Southern Baptist delegates overwhelmingly endorsed a ban on same-sex marriage, calling for the overturning of Obergefell v. Hodges. They also urged legislative action against sports betting and policies promoting childbearing. This assertive stance, passed without debate, reflects the denomination's conservative views on marriage and family. The meeting was also overshadowed by the recent death of a sexual abuse whistleblower, highlighting ongoing concerns about reform within the SBC.
